首页 > 数据库 >mysql8免安装版安装教程

mysql8免安装版安装教程

时间:2023-03-24 16:22:32浏览次数:58  
标签:初始化 教程 utf8mb4 mysql8 安装版 windows mysql 安装

windows安装mysql8免安装版教程,附网盘资源


目录


链接:https://pan.baidu.com/s/1_qagfA-i7CbeWG3urIAlgw?pwd=iidx

提取码:iidx

一、前言

本次使用的mysql版本为mysql8.0.32,安装的系统为windows系统。使用免安装的方式进行安装配置。

二、安装配置流程

2.1、下载并解压

将下载的压缩包文件解压至你想安装的位置。

2.2、设置Mysql配置文件

在mysql根目录下创建一个my.ini配置文件,配置内容如下:

[mysqld]
# 设置3306端口
port=3306
# 设置mysql的安装目录,一定要与上面的安装路径保持一致
basedir=D:\\MySQL\\mysql-8.0.20-winx64
# 设置mysql数据库的数据的存放目录,自动生成,无需手动创建,当然也可以放在其他地方
datadir=D:\\MySQL\\mysql-8.0.20-winx64\\Data
# 允许最大连接数
max_connections=200
# 允许连接失败的次数。
max_connect_errors=10
# 服务端使用的字符集默认为utf8mb4
character-set-server=utf8mb4
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
# 默认使用“mysql_native_password”插件认证
#mysql_native_password
default_authentication_plugin=mysql_native_password
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8mb4
[client]
# 设置mysql客户端连接服务端时默认使用的端口,不建议修改,这是公认端口号
port=3306
default-character-set=utf8mb4

image-20230321184748884

2.3、初始化mysql

配置完成后,进入bin目录中,在上方的路径中输入cmd,在该文件夹中打开命令提示符。

image-20230321184936438

在命令提示符中输入初始化代码完成mysql初始化:

mysqld --initialize --console

image-20230321185136715

2.4、创建mysql的windows的服务

还是在cmd中输入以下命令,为windows创建Mysql服务并启动Mysql。

mysqld --install

image-20230321185523848

出现如上图的提示表示安装成功了。

image-20230321185916118

# 启动mysql的服务
net start mysql
# 关闭mysql的服务
net stop mysql

2.5、修改初始密码

启动mysql服务,修改密码。

登录mysql的命令:

# -p后面直接跟刚才初始化生成的密码
mysql -u root -p你的密码 

image-20230321190119347

修改密码的命令:

ALTER USER 'root'@'localhost' IDENTIFIED BY '你的密码';

image-20230321190420578

修改密码后,输入“exit;”即可退出mysql。

2.6、(可选)配置环境变量

配置mysql环境变量,不然每次启动mysql都需要进入到mysql中的bin目录里进行操作,非常麻烦。

输入win+R打开运行窗口,输入sysdm.cpl打开环境变量窗口。将mysql中到bin目录的路径复制下来新增到path中即可。

image-20230321190852189

现在就可以随便使用mysql命令了。

标签:初始化,教程,utf8mb4,mysql8,安装版,windows,mysql,安装
From: https://www.cnblogs.com/x1126-xx/p/17244639.html

相关文章

  • gitee使用教程
    版权声明:本文为CSDN博主「林新发」的原创文章,遵循CC4.0BY-SA版权协议,转载请附上原文出处链接及本声明。原文链接:https://blog.csdn.net/linxinfa/article/details/108709......
  • oh-my-zsh快速安装教程
    1.下载执行脚本(国内gitee镜像)wgethttps://gitee.com/hao-qirui/oh-my-zsh-install.sh.git2.直接执行sudoshinstall.sh如果终端出现箭头表示安装成功,或者zsh--v......
  • m1 docker mysql8/arm64v8 解决 `only_full_group_by` 问题
    m1dockermysql8/arm64v8解决only_full_group_by问题问题原因MySql从5.7版本开始默认开启only_full_group_by规则,规则核心原则如下,没有遵循原则的sql会被认为是不合......
  • Runway一键生成Ai智能视频后期必备神器!附视频使用教程
    今天分享的这款工具太强大了,只需输入文字,即可利用Ai算法抠像,它就是Runway!人工智能视频后期处理工具。只需要输入你想实现的视频效果,依靠强大的AI人工智能算法,就可以直接......
  • Git教程
    Git教程Git是一种分布式版本控制系统,可以让你在不同的电脑上协作开发项目,同时保留每次修改的历史记录。Git有很多优点,比如速度快、灵活、安全、易于分支和合并等。Git......
  • Wireshark使用教程
    以下是更详细的Wireshark使用教程:下载和安装Wireshark您可以从Wireshark官网(https://www.wireshark.org/)下载Wireshark软件。在下载和安装过程中,请确保选择正确的操作系统版......
  • Wireshark使用教程
    以下是更详细的Wireshark使用教程:下载和安装Wireshark您可以从Wireshark官网(https://www.wireshark.org/)下载Wireshark软件。在下载和安装过程中,请确保选择正确的操作系统版......
  • CentOS7关机重启之后,Mysql8启动不成功
    我在自己电脑上使用VM工具安装了虚拟机,CentOS7,里面继续安装了mysql8,下班的时候,直接把整个虚拟机关机了,没有依次关闭里面的服务,早上来的时候发现启动不来mysql 它提示用......
  • 自己动手从零写桌面操作系统GrapeOS系列教程——22.文件系统与FAT16
    学习操作系统原理最好的方法是自己写一个简单的操作系统。新买的硬盘和优盘在第一次使用时需要格式化,有时候还需要分区。这是为什么呢?分区和格式化到底是干啥呢?本讲将......
  • 【MySQL】MySQL8.0 创建用户及授权 - 看这篇就足够了
    什么时候会用到对接外系统时,需要给其余系统开放访问权限本系统中,分权限管理数据,防止root权限删库跑路......